7 A particle \(P\) moves in a straight line. The velocity \(v \mathrm {~m} \mathrm {~s} ^ { - 1 }\) at time \(t\) seconds is given by
$$\begin{array} { l l }
v = 0.5 t & \text { for } 0 \leqslant t \leqslant 10
v = 0.25 t ^ { 2 } - 8 t + 60 & \text { for } 10 \leqslant t \leqslant 20
\end{array}$$
- Show that there is an instantaneous change in the acceleration of the particle at \(t = 10\).
- Find the total distance covered by \(P\) in the interval \(0 \leqslant t \leqslant 20\).
